Baccarat and Punto Banco gameplay overview
Baccarat is a long-standing card game played between two hands, known as the player and the banker. The objective is to bet on which hand will have a total value closest to nine. In the Punto Banco variation, cards valued two through nine are worth their face value, aces are worth one, and tens or face cards are worth zero. If a hand totals eight or nine initially, it is considered a natural win.
Gameplay involves specific rules for drawing a third card if the initial totals are low. Betting options typically include the player, the banker, or a tie. The banker bet generally offers a lower house edge, approximately 1.06%, compared to other options.
